Non-Ferric Alum is a better and purer form of Aluminum Sulphate. It is made up of Aluminum Trihydrate with a chemical formula Al2(SO4)3. It is a white crystalline solid color. And when in anhydrous form it becomes color less. Non-Ferric Alum is odor less and is non-toxic and non-combustible. It is available in powder or solid form and is multifaceted compound. It has wet tensile strength, preventing moisture from damaging the compound. The major difference between Non-Ferric Alum and Ferric Alum is that Ferric Alum is made up of Bauxite as the raw material, whereas Non-Ferric Alum is made up of Aluminum Trihydrate. Slabs can also be made up from Non-Ferric Alum when the raw material is processed under suitable conditions, with Sulphuric Acid. Being non-toxic and soluble in water makes it vital chemical in many industries, thought its insoluble in ethanol. Non-Ferric Alum is used for wastewater treatment and purification of drinking water. It also finds its application in various industries like Medicine, Pharmaceutical and Cosmetics Industry, Paper and Pulp Industry, Oil and Petroleum and Dyeing Industry and even in Textile Industry. Alum, also known as aluminum sulfate, is a chemical compound with the formula Al2(SO4)3. It is widely recognized for its versatile applications in various industries. Alum is commonly used as a coagulant in water treatment processes to clarify turbid water by removing suspended particles. Additionally, it has a history of use in pickling to crisp fruits and vegetables and as an ingredient in baking powder for leavening. Alum also finds use in cosmetics, textiles, and as a mordant in dyeing processes. Its astringent properties have made it a traditional remedy for various skin conditions. Overall, alum's ability to form solid precipitates and its diverse range of applications make it a valuable chemical compound in both industrial and household settings.
